🌱 Sprout Tomato and Chili – Step by Step
What you’ll need:
Seedling pots or trays
Small used pots from store-bought cuttings work fine.
If you’re sprouting for containers under 8-10 liters, you can sow seeds directly in the final pot.
(Your plants will usually grow better if you transplant them once or twice.)Good quality seed starting mix or coco coir
Coco coir is easy to find in blocks at garden centers or hardware stores – great if you have limited space.
If using coco coir, mix in ½ teaspoon of worm compost per pot for nutrients.Good tomato or chili seeds
Quality seeds = strong plants. Buy from trusted sellers with good reviews.Tweezers or a small spoon
To handle seeds without touching them (they’re delicate).Spray bottle (or gentle watering can)
To keep the soil moist without drowning it.
🚀 Let’s get started:
- Fill your pot or tray with soil.
Press it down lightly to make the surface even. - Make a small hole – about 0.5 cm deep.
- Pick up a seed with tweezers, or pour it onto a plate and move it into the hole.
- Cover the seed with 2–5 mm of soil so it’s protected from light.
- Spray the soil generously with water.
The soil should be moist – not soaking wet.
💡 While you wait:
Use a spray bottle to mist the soil once a day, or
Cover the pot with a lid or cling film – then you only need to check every 3–4 days.
Make sure the soil doesn’t dry out.
⏳ Germination can take 2–14 days, depending on the seed type and quality.
👉 Chili seeds often take longer – be patient and check the expected sprouting time on the seed pack.
